Par-fect for the family: Glow-in-the-dark mini golf course opens in Abilene

Abilene's newest kid-friendly mini golf course is par-fect escape from the summer sun.

Glo-N-One Mini Golf is located at the Mall of Abilene, 4310 Buffalo Gap Road, by Auntie Anne's officially opened June 15.

Abilene is the second Glo-N-One location open. The first location is in San Angelo at Sunset Mall.

The indoor miniature glow-in-the-dark course offers fun for the entire family with two rounds of play per admission.

Prices to play vary by age:

  • Regular admission is $9.

  • Children age 5 and under is $6.

  • Children age 2 and under are free with prior admission purchase.

Admission for groups of five or more cost $8 per player.

Glo-N-One offers birthday party packages for $99 which includes 90-minute party with up to 12 players, free use of the party zone during scheduled party time and free glow necklaces and one shot at the prize hole per player. Reservation is required.

Glo-N-One Abilene is open noon-8 p.m. Monday through Friday, 11 a.m.-8 p.m. Saturday and noon-6 p.m. Sunday.
